uml图 学生管理系统
时间: 2023-12-25 18:04:41 浏览: 80
根据提供的引用内容,以下是学生管理系统的UML图:
```
@startuml
class 学生 {
- 学号
- 姓名
- 年龄
- 性别
- 学院
- 专业
- 班级
+ 查询学生信息()
+ 修改学生信息()
}
class 宿舍楼 {
- 楼号
- 管理员
- 房间列表
+ 查询宿舍信息()
+ 添加房间()
+ 删除房间()
}
class 宿舍房间 {
- 房间号
- 床位列表
+ 查询房间信息()
+ 添加床位()
+ 删除床位()
}
class 管理员 {
- 账号
- 密码
+ 登录()
+ 查询学生信息()
+ 查询宿舍信息()
+ 添加学生()
+ 删除学生()
+ 添加宿舍()
+ 删除宿舍()
}
学生 -- 管理员
宿舍楼 -- 管理员
宿舍楼 -- 宿舍房间
@enduml
```
相关问题
uml学生管理系统时序图
以下是一个UML学生管理系统的时序图示例:
```plantuml
@startuml
actor 学生
participant 学生管理系统
participant 数据库
学生 -> 学生管理系统: 登录
学生管理系统 -> 学生管理系统: 验证登录信息
学生管理系统 -> 数据库: 查询学生信息
数据库 --> 学生管理系统: 返回学生信息
学生管理系统 -> 学生管理系统: 显示学生信息
学生 -> 学生管理系统: 选课
学生管理系统 -> 学生管理系统: 验证选课信息
学生管理系统 -> 数据库: 查询课程信息
数据库 --> 学生管理系统: 返回课程信息
学生管理系统 -> 学生管理系统: 显示课程信息
学生 -> 学生管理系统: 查看成绩
学生管理系统 -> 学生管理系统: 查询成绩信息
学生管理系统 -> 数据库: 查询成绩信息
数据库 --> 学生管理系统: 返回成绩信息
学生管理系统 -> 学生管理系统: 显示成绩信息
学生 -> 学生管理系统: 评教
学生管理系统 -> 学生管理系统: 验证评教信息
学生管理系统 -> 数据库: 保存评教结果
数据库 --> 学生管理系统: 保存成功
学生管理系统 -> 学生管理系统: 显示评教结果
@enduml
```
uml图学生成绩管理系统
在学生成绩管理系统中,我们可以使用UML图来描述系统的架构和功能。根据引用和引用的内容,我们可以使用构件图来表示学生成绩管理系统的组成部分。在构件图中,我们可以创建学员类、系统管理员类、成绩类和系统数据库类的构件,分别对应于系统中的各个功能模块和数据存储。构件图可以帮助我们直观地了解系统的组成和关联关系,以及各个构件之间的交互和依赖关系。引用中提到了系统的功能性需求,我们可以通过构件图来进一步说明这些功能在系统中的实现方式和关系。通过使用UML图,我们可以更好地理解和设计学生成绩管理系统。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[考试成绩管理系统的UML建立](https://blog.csdn.net/chenyujing1234/article/details/8286075)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]